Woman Gives Birth to quintuplets After 23 Years Of Childlessness; Stranded at Hospital Over N3.7m Bill (Photo)

A Nigerian woman who suffered for many years without a child has cried out after giving birth to five babies (quintuplets) and being detained at a hospital.

It was gathered that the woman, Mrs Abigail Musa, delivered five babies after 23 years of barrenness, but has been denied her freedom at the Fertile Ground Hospital, Zaramaganda Road, Jos, Plateau State, over an accumulated hospital bill of N3.7m.

According to a report by Punch, Abigail had been staying in the hospital for the past three and half months when the babies were born.

Also, two of the babies were said to have died.

Her husband, Mr Garba Musa, a pastor with the Church of Christ in Nations, told newsmen on Sunday that efforts to raise the bill and take his wife and the three surviving babies home had been abortive.

He said,

“My wife and the babies were discharged from the hospital about two days ago, but we could not go home due to the hospital bill.

“It’s really a big challenge, which we do not know how to handle because the outstanding money, which the doctor said must be paid before we leave, is N3.7m. This is just too much for us.”

Explaining how the hospital bill accumulated, the cleric said,

“My wife had been at the hospital for three months and three weeks. When she gave birth to the five babies through operation, they were premature, which necessitated that they put them inside incubators.

“My wife was charged N3,000 and each baby consumed N5,000 every day. Almost every two days, tests were run on the babies, which took N3,000. There were other charges also, and that was how the money amounted to such a huge amount.

“Although two of the babies could not make it, we thank God for everything. The hospital management said many people in the past who promised to pay after they were discharged, disappeared without a trace. We need help in our present situation.”

Garba, who described the birth of the babies as a miracle, recalled how people mocked him and his wife for the past 23 years over their bareness.

“At a point, some people advised my wife to divorce me; they also came to me and offered similar advice. It was not easy, but I thank God for my wife because whenever we were tempted to divorce, God gave us the grace to resist it,” he added.

Devil responsible for rising rape cases – Commissioner for Women Affairs Adamawa

Commissioner for Women Affairs in Adamawa State, Lami Ahmed, has blamed the rising cases of rape in Nigeria to the devil.

She made the statement while speaking to The Punch, as she said there is also a breakdown in family values, resulting in higher divorce rates which then exposes children to abuse.

“To me, the reason why the cases of rape are increasing every day is because rape is the handiwork of the devil. There’s a breakdown in family values resulting in a higher rate of divorce.

“Situations such as the separation of the father and mother can sometimes expose the child to abuse either from a family member or neighbours.

“If laws are put in place, they will curtail the incidence. But because there’s no law yet in place, we are confronted with the menace of rape and the sharp rise in gender-based violence,” she said.

The commissioner noted that stigmatisation is a major reason rape victims do not speak up, adding that when rape occurs, the parents of a victim or the victim might fear being identified and stigmatised.

House maid sentenced to four years in prison for feeding her boss’ baby with urine and infected her with syphilis

A Ugandan househelp, Vicky Abiria has been sentenced for feeding her boss’s baby with her urine.

Abiria was sentenced to four years imprisonment by Kira division court on Friday, December 11.

Hope Chica, the mother of the baby told the police that she got suspicious after noticing that Abira had kept the baby’s bottle packed with urine in her bedroom.

Upon interrogation, she confessed that she was giving the child her urine.

“I found my baby’s bottle full of urine and when I asked her she confessed that she was feeding my baby with her urine,” she said.

Chica added that: “When I took my daughter to the hospital, the doctors found out that my baby had syphilis. I am now trying to treat my child and make sure that she doesn’t get other complications.”

She further added that she always saw these kinds of acts on social media and television and didn’t really think that they were true.

“I have always heard that house helps do these kinds of things, now that it has happened to my child, I even fear maids. I don’t ever want to hire one. I have always treated this girl well but I don’t know why she decided to do such a thing,” she said.

Kampala Metropolitan Police (KMP) Spokesperson Patrick Onyango had on Thursday, December 10, confirmed that they arrested Abira and charged her with spreading dangerous diseases after tests on the child proved that it had been infected by a urinary tract infection.

I regret bleaching my skin – Veteran highlife singer , Obuoba Adofo

Veteran Ghanaian highlife artiste, Obuoba J. A. Adofo, has admitted that he can never forgive himself for bleaching his skin when he was at the peak of his career.

The Ghanaian Veteran said this during a recent interview with Graphic Showbiz.

In his words ;

“You know at that time, bleaching and having permed, curly hair meant a lot to people who thought they had arrived. As a musician at my peak, I wanted to feel that sense of belonging so I bleached my skin.

I thought that that way, people would know that I was a big man, but later I regretted my actions having learnt of the complications of bleaching and the consequences people suffered.

I even found out that it was difficult for surgeries to be performed on bleached skin. Till date, I feel guilty for doing that and really wish I could change the hands of time”.
